In order to create coffee with a delicious, rich flavor, try a French press. Coffee makers can leech out some of the flavor in coffee because of the coffee filter. A French press works by using a plunger to push the ground beans down to the base of the pot. This increases the amount of flavorful oils in your container.

If your coffee machine is a bit outdated, this trick will more than make up for it. Before you start to brew coffee, simply brew a whole pot of water. After you have run a full pot of water through the machine, add your coffee grounds and pour the heated water back into your coffee maker. This makes the hottest and tastiest coffee you can get.

Use clean and fresh water when brewing your coffee. The coffee you make will only be as tasty as the water used. Try tasting the water before using it in the machine.

When brewing a pot of coffee, ensure you use the appropriate amount of water. If you don’t use enough water, your coffee will be far too strong. However, if you use too much water, your coffee will taste watered down. A good practice is to use two cups water for every desired cup of coffee.

Do not reheat brewed coffee. Instead, you can purchase a thermal mug, which will retain the heat of the coffee for a long period of time. If you don’t have one, you can brew a second pot.

Good water is critical. Always remember that anything involved in the brewing process has the possibility of affecting your coffee’s taste. Use bottled water or filtered water for the best results.

Freshly roasted beans make the best coffee. Check expiration dates on whole beans before purchasing. Also, try to find out when the beans were roasted. Rather than purchasing coffee beans at a grocery store, consider a coffee shop or other specialty store.

Don’t put coffee by the oven. Heat can stifle the quality of your coffee beans. You should not leave the coffee on the counter near the stove or in a cupboard above it.

Decide how many cups of coffee you wish to brew. In cooking, a cup is equal to eight ounces. However, regular coffee cups generally hold only six. For every 6 ounces of water you should use 2 tablespoons of coffee. Using a measuring cup will result in a watered down brew.

You do not have to quit caffeine in one bold move. Try brewing “semi” caffeine-free coffee. Do this by mixing regular beans with decaf beans. If you’re using pre-ground coffee, use equal parts in the coffee machine.
